ZMCT103C – 1000:1 Miniature AC Current Transformer (5 A → 5 mA)

Key Features & Ratings

  • Type: Miniature PCB-mount current transformer (CT) / micro-current transformer.

  • Turns Ratio: 1000 : 1 — Primary 1 turn (the wire through the hole), Secondary ~1000 turns.

  • Rated Primary Current: 5 A AC (50/60 Hz) → produces 5 mA output on secondary when 5 A flows through primary.

  • Linear Range: 0 A up to ~10 A (with appropriate burden resistor) — many sellers and datasheets list usable range up to ~10 A.

  • Output (Secondary): 5 mA (at 5 A primary). Many modules include a burden resistor to convert to a measurable voltage.

  • Accuracy Class / Linearity: 0.2 class, linearity ≤ 0.2% over typical use range (~5% to 120 % of rated current).

  • Phase Angle Error: ≤ 15′ (minutes) when input is 5 A and using a 50 Ω sampling resistor (i.e. phase error minimal, good for power measurement).

  • Isolation (Dielectric Strength): Up to 4500 V (isolation between primary and secondary), providing galvanic isolation — important for safety when measuring mains AC.

  • Encapsulation & Build: Epoxy-sealed, PCB-mountable with straight-through primary hole (wire under test passes through center).

  • Operating Temperature Range: −40 °C to +85 °C (some listings up to +70 °C) depending on datasheet version.


Typical Usage & Application Notes

  • AC current measurement & energy monitoring: Useful for building power meters, load monitors, energy sensors for mains or AC loads.

  • Galvanic isolation between mains and MCU: Because of high isolation voltage (4500 V), good for safely measuring mains current while keeping control circuitry (Arduino/ESP etc.) isolated.

  • Works as a current transformer: Primary is simply the wire through the hole; secondary output is a current — you need to add a burden resistor across the secondary to convert that current into a measurable voltage (then feed to ADC or amplifier).

  • Module compatibility: Commonly used with microcontrollers / ADC (Arduino, STM32, etc.). If using raw CT (without amplifier), ensure proper burden resistor and offset to avoid negative voltage swings.

  • Range considerations: While rated 5 A, module may handle somewhat higher currents short-term, but accuracy and transformer saturation may degrade — best for ≤5 A continuous for accurate readout.
